The Streaming Servers: Your Culinary Battleground
The easiest way to get your Soma fix is through streaming services. Think of them as your all-you-can-eat buffet of anime!
Crunchyroll: This is arguably the best option. Crunchyroll is basically the king of anime streaming. They usually have new episodes available soon after they air in Japan, and they offer a massive library. You'll find all seasons of Shokugeki no Soma there, ready to binge. Plus, they have subtitles in multiple languages, so you can understand exactly what culinary wizardry is happening on screen.

Hulu: Hulu is another solid contender. It's like that reliable friend who always has your back. While their anime selection might not be as vast as Crunchyroll's, they do carry Shokugeki no Soma. Just double-check that they have all the seasons available in your region.
Netflix: Ah, Netflix, the comfort food of streaming. They’ve got a good range of anime, but whether or not they have all the seasons of Food Wars! available depends on your location. It's always worth checking, though, because who doesn't love a good Netflix binge?

HIDIVE: This service is worth considering if you're a hardcore anime fan. They often have some more niche titles and sometimes even exclusive content. While it may be less well known, keep an eye out for it!
The Caveats: A Few Words of Wisdom
Before you dive headfirst into the deliciousness, a few things to keep in mind:
Region Locking: Sometimes, due to licensing agreements, a show might not be available in your country. It's like finding your favorite ice cream flavor is sold out – disappointing, but you can always find another treat! A VPN might help, but always check the terms of service of the streaming platform and respect copyright laws.

Subscription Costs: Most of these services require a subscription. Think of it as an investment in your entertainment (and your virtual taste buds!). However, many offer free trials, so you can sample the goods before committing.
Availability Changes: Streaming catalogs change all the time. Just like your local grocery store might stop carrying your favorite cereal, shows can disappear from streaming services. So, if you see Shokugeki no Soma, don't hesitate to start watching!

Why Should You Even Care About Food Wars!?
Besides the obvious – the mouthwatering food, the intense cooking battles, and the ridiculously over-the-top reactions – Shokugeki no Soma is genuinely entertaining. It's like watching a cooking competition show, but with anime flair. Each dish is presented with such passion and creativity that you'll find yourself craving things you never thought you would. Seriously, even a simple egg dish becomes an epic culinary adventure.
It's also a surprisingly heartwarming story about friendship, rivalry, and the pursuit of excellence. Soma's journey from a humble diner to a prestigious culinary academy is inspiring, and you'll find yourself rooting for him every step of the way. Plus, the characters are all wonderfully unique and relatable, even the ones who seem a bit…eccentric.
